Hi all,
I am in the process of putting together a system.... All up the receiver and
speakers will set me back 3,500 (almost 2,800 on speakers) and the rest on a
capable receiver....
By the way those values above were in Aussie Dollars (so about 1,500 pounds,
or 2,800 approx USD)
My question is simple for a 6m by 6m room what kind of budget should i be
expecting.....
If i have to budget for better price cabling i would prefer the high end
stuff on the fronts and centre, and a lower quality on the
backs...........as to run the stuff up the wall and through the roof will
require about 10 metres on each back speaker... (i know i have a current
system surrounds mounted back there).

Buy a big spool of generic 12-gauge zipcord, or whatever they call it
there. In the States it'd go for no more than $1 /m, probably less in
bulk. Really, you don't need anything better than that.

I agree with Bob on this one. I am in the custom audio/video business
and have discovered that hi-end cabling is mostly a sham. As long as
your impedances remain acceptable, go with the generic 12.
